Who is it for
The computer games industry has become one of the fastest developing disciplines across the globe. Learning how to design games covers a wide range of skills, and you will be exploring and developing the fundamental tools required for game design, including 3D modelling, Sound design, level design, texturing and designing a game using Unreal Engine.
Grow as the industry grows and research gaming for developing technologies like AR and VR.
Craft stories and narratives to take the player into the world you have created and design the sounds needed to bring that world to life.

How is the course assessed
All units are assessed via coursework, over a 2 year program of study. There are 2 units to complete per year, with the first unit being delivered across three smaller projects (see below)
A1 Skills Development: 3 x assignments
A2 Creative Project: 1 x assignment
B1 Personal Progression: 1 x assignment
B2 Creative Industry Response: 1 x assignment
Work is assessed at Pass, Merit, and Distinction level. The qualification carries UCAS tariff points allowing learners to move on to Higher Education (University degree programs).
